Output 21df302965e3786358a018704701844ce0fdc2eae62873124cf21e24c66b9583:6

value
43895587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87883793df70480de9de6a6c0deef75a491d34c5 OP_EQUAL
address
MLFndrgKwN929WZGMzpEndUwbsg7AuLwwz
transaction
21df302965e3786358a018704701844ce0fdc2eae62873124cf21e24c66b9583
spent
true